Veryfi Receipts OCR API automatically extracts the guest count directly from the receipt itself — no manual input required. When a restaurant prints the number of covers or guests on the check (as shown above with “Guest Count: 18”), Veryfi captures this as a structured guest_count field in the API response.

This data feeds directly into Veryfi’s Attendee Validation feature, which calculates the per-head spend and benchmarks it against typical meal ranges. In the example above, a $690.89 bill for 18 guests works out to $38.38 per person — falling within the $30–$50/head benchmark and flagged as Within Benchmark.
Should you want to control a flexible spend across different time of day you can do that also by taking advantage of the date JSON key/value in the API response.

For T&E auditors and finance teams, this means the headcount on the expense claim can be automatically cross-checked against what’s printed on the receipt — eliminating one of the most common forms of meal expense abuse without any manual review.
